Output 8f4d64235c5325196e6c6b361431c1369f0c318498fb22b57ddbeec1a1609699:0

value
29306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7408e2c17a782e0122a9fd8a73ff85edb520f654 OP_EQUAL
address
3CGYxBxsrQWU1d2tdrU1ZafkuFtcf9WciC
transaction
8f4d64235c5325196e6c6b361431c1369f0c318498fb22b57ddbeec1a1609699
confirmations
223582
spent
true